YES — Iowa has adopted 2018 IECC which requires HVAC loads be calculated per ACCA Manual J for new construction and major renovations.
Iowa has adopted 2018 IECC as the statewide energy code for residential construction.

Iowa includes IECC climate zones 5A, 6A. Zone 5A is most common, covering cities like Des Moines, Cedar Rapids, Davenport. Climate zone data determines design temperatures and insulation requirements used in Manual J calculations.
